ABOUT THE WINE

While Albariño is most famously associated with Rías Baixas, “Sketch” is born from a maritime plot in the village of Dena, just meters from the Atlantic coast—though bottled under Bierzo for regulatory reasons. Vines are over 60 years old, farmed organically on decomposed granite soils that lend the wine its signature stony intensity. Grapes are hand-harvested, whole-cluster pressed, and fermented with native yeasts in neutral vessels. The wine is aged on the lees for 12 months in old French barrels, often submerged in the ocean during part of élevage, a nod to Pérez’s experimental, site-sensitive style. Aromatically, “Sketch” evokes wet stones, lime blossom, and oyster shell, with flavors of preserved lemon, underripe peach, and fennel. It is a compelling, saline white that pairs naturally with crudo, razor clams, or grilled turbot.

ABOUT THE PRODUCER

Raúl Pérez is widely regarded as one of Spain’s most visionary and intuitive winemakers, revered for his instinct-driven methods and deep connection to site. Hailing from Valtuille de Abajo in Bierzo, he began his career with his family’s winery before establishing his own label, crafting wines across multiple regions with minimal intervention and maximum terroir expression. Pérez farms organically, works exclusively with native yeasts, and often eschews sulfur and new oak. Each cuvée reflects a quest to translate vineyard energy and tradition through pure, living wines. “Sketch” exemplifies his boundary-pushing philosophy, challenging conventions around place, aging, and typicity, all while honoring the Atlantic soul of Albariño.
